Great sandwich!!! I used rotisserie chicken instead and it was delicious. I did forget to get tomatoes so it was a little thick. I think the tomatoes would have cut the heaviness of the sauce. I had some leftover cranberry sauce and used it on my sandwich and it was perfect. Definitely recommend!
